When using a Generic Pool Operation, MaxPoolOperator, MinPoolOperator or AvgPoolOperator, are influenced by the following kernel code
filter.reset();
for (int filter_y = 0; filter_y < filter_rows; ++filter_y) {
for (int filter_x = 0; filter_x < filter_cols; ++filter_x) {
// for (int in_channel = 0; in_channel < input_depth;// ++in_channel) {constint in_x = in_x_origin + filter_x;
constint in_y = in_y_origin + filter_y;
T input_value;
if ((in_x >= 0) && (in_x < input_cols) && (in_y >= 0) &&
(in_y < input_rows)) {
// Commenting out since these indices might be useful later/* size_t input_index = batch * input_rows * input_cols * input_depth + in_y * input_cols * input_depth + in_x * input_depth + in_channel; input_value = in((uint32_t)input_index);*/
input_value = in(batch, in_y, in_x, out_channel);
} else {
input_value = 0; <= ZERO value here messes with the result
}
// size_t filter_index = filter_y * filter_cols * input_depth *// filter_count +// filter_x * input_depth * filter_count +// in_channel * filter_count + out_channel;// const T filter_value = filter(filter_index);
filter.PartialCompute(input_value, filter_y, filter_x,
out_channel, out_channel);
//}
}
}
I believe the PartialCompute is incorrectly calculated due to the zero value. If 0 is less than a MinFilter tmp result, or 0 is greater than the MaxFilter tmp result, the value will be 0, in the output tensor.
